U.S. Navy warship brings over 300 sailors to Mobile to let the good times roll

MOBILE, Ala. (WKRG) — Mobile’s 2026 Mardi Gras Ship is in port, with more than 300 U.S. Navy sailors aboard the USS Farragut in town to celebrate Mardi Gras in the Port City.

Everyone aboard agrees they’re ready to let the good times roll.

“I saw what it was like in New Orleans. I can’t wait to see what it’s like here in Mobile, Alabama,” one sailor told News 5.

This guided missile destroyer brought more than 300 sailors here to Mobile to join in on the revelry.

“Well, I know there’s a couple of places you can get crawfish to eat around here, so I’m really excited to eat some crawfish,” Ryan Straughanz said. “And I’m excited to go to some parades.”…
